Understanding the Power of Data in Appointment Setting

Data stands as the cornerstone of effective appointment setting, allowing businesses to refine their strategies and engage potential clients with precision. By harnessing analytics, organizations can cultivate a deeper understanding of their target audience, which leads to improved engagement rates. Some key factors include:

  • Identifying High-Value Leads: Data helps prioritize leads based on likelihood to convert, ensuring your team focuses their efforts where it matters most.
  • Personalization of Outreach: Tailoring communication to align with the specific interests of the prospects increases response rates significantly.
  • Timing Analysis: Analyzing when leads are most responsive allows teams to schedule outreach that maximizes engagement.

Moreover, tracking metrics over time allows for continuous improvement of appointment-setting tactics. Teams can utilize the following data points to enhance their approach:

Metric Importance
Lead Source Determines which channels provide the highest quality leads.
Response Rate Indicates the effectiveness of your outreach messaging.
Conversion Rate Measures the percentage of appointments that turn into sales.

By constantly analyzing these metrics, teams can pivot their strategies to align with evolving market demands and client expectations, thus bolstering their appointment-setting efforts and driving greater business success.

Identifying Key Metrics for Enhanced Lead Engagement

Understanding the right metrics can dramatically boost your ability to engage leads effectively. Start by tracking conversion rates for various lead sources. This allows you to pinpoint which channels are most effective in attracting high-quality leads. Additionally, pay attention to the engagement metrics such as email open rates and click-through rates, which reflect how well your messaging resonates with your audience. By analyzing these data points, you can tweak your outreach strategies to appeal more to your target demographics.

Another critical metric is the time-to-engagement, which measures how quickly leads respond after initial contact. Faster engagement methods can lead to higher conversions, meaning you should explore your average response times and look for ways to improve. Implementing an automated lead scoring system can further enhance this process, as it prioritizes leads based on their activity levels and behaviors. For a clearer overview of these metrics, consider using a simple table format:

Metric Description Importance
Conversion Rate Percentage of leads that convert into appointments Identifies effective lead sources
Email Open Rate Rate at which emails sent to leads are opened Indicates messaging effectiveness
Time-to-Engagement Average time taken to respond to leads Directly correlates to conversion potential

Tailoring Your Approach with Predictive Analytics

Harnessing predictive analytics can transform your approach to appointment setting by providing actionable insights tailored to your target audience. By analyzing historical data trends, businesses can identify potential customers’ preferences, pain points, and optimal engagement times. Key strategies to consider include:

  • Segmentation: Grouping prospects based on behavior patterns allows for personalized outreach.
  • Timing Optimization: Predictive models can suggest the best times for follow-ups and reminders, increasing your chances of securing an appointment.
  • Lead Scoring: Assess potential leads’ readiness to engage allows you to prioritize high-value prospects.

For your predictive analytics to be effective, it’s essential to continuously refine your data inputs and model assumptions. Regularly updating your datasets ensures that you are working with the most relevant information, allowing your team to make informed decisions. It’s also beneficial to integrate analytics into your CRM systems, enhancing your ability to track interactions and outcomes. Consider the following metrics for evaluation:

Metric Description Importance
Conversion Rate Percentage of leads that result in appointments. Measures effectiveness of your appointment strategy.
Follow-Up Frequency How often leads are contacted. Determines engagement levels and responsiveness.
Lead Response Time Time taken to respond to inquiries. Directly impacts customer satisfaction and conversions.

Implementing Automation Tools for Streamlined Processes

To enhance appointment setting efficiency, implementing automation tools can transform the way businesses manage their processes. By leveraging data-driven insights, companies can identify patterns in customer behavior and tailor their outreach accordingly. Automation tools can help you:

  • Schedule appointments automatically: Reduce the back-and-forth communication by allowing clients to pick their own time slots based on your availability.
  • Send reminders: Automate confirmation and reminder emails or SMS to reduce no-shows.
  • Collect valuable data: Track interactions and feedback automatically to improve future engagements.

Integrating these tools into your workflow not only saves time but also enhances the overall customer experience. For a clearer idea of the benefits, consider the following table that outlines key automation features and their respective advantages:

Automation Feature Advantage
Calendars Integration Seamless synchronization with existing calendars to avoid conflicts.
Customizable Templates Consistent branding and messaging in communications.
Performance Analytics In-depth analysis of appointment trends to refine strategies.
